Electric rates in New Summerfield
Residential rates range from 17.7¢ to 17.7¢ per kWh.
Providers include Cherokee County Elec Coop Assn - (TX), Houston County Elec Coop Inc, Oncor Electric Delivery Company LLC.
This is 18% above the national average of 15.0¢/kWh.
Note: Texas has a competitive electricity market — you may be able to choose your supplier.
